Condonation request for filing Statutory Forms_ User Manual
1. Overview
Sometimes it may happen that due to un-avoidance circumstances we could not file income tax Statutory Forms within the time allowed. In such cases, system does not allow filing of Statutory Forms for that period.
subject to the permission by the appropriate competent authority of Income Tax. Any person who did not furnish his income tax Statutory Forms due to circumstances beyond his control, can file income tax Statutory Forms.
This facility of condonation request available on Income Tax e-filing portal can be used by Taxpayer who did not file forms before the due date.
2. Prerequisites for availing this service
- Registered user on the e-Filing portal with valid username and password.
- Taxpayer did not file Statutory Forms within the time limit.

4. How to Raise Condonation requests to file Forms
Step 1: Log in to the e-Filing portal using your user ID and password.
Step 2: On your Dashboard, click 'Services' > 'Condonation Request'.
Step 3: On Condonation Request page select 'Application for Statutory Forms' and click 'Continue'.
Step 4: Click '+Create Condonation Request' to raise the request.
Step 5: Click on 'Start New Filing'.
Step 6: Enter the required information (Residential status, Details related to form not filed, write reason of delay of form and attach necessary attachments) Click on 'Proceed to e-Verify'.
Step 7: Select the suitable method for the verification and click 'Continue'.
Step 8: After verification your request will be submitted, and transaction Id will be generated. You will also receive the confirmation on registered mail Id and Mobile No.
You can view the Condonation request by clicking on 'View Condonation Request'.
Step 9: Here are the condonation requests raised by you click on 'View Details' to view the details of condonation request.

Step 10: Here are the Details of the condonation request. You can also download the Approval letter by clicking on 'Download Approval Letter'.
